_fileStream (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
_frameSizes (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
_frameTypes (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
_header (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
_lastTimeChange (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
_nextVideoTrack (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
_startTime (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
_videoCodecAccuracy (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
addStreamFileTrack(const Common::Path &baseName) | Video::VideoDecoder | |
addStreamTrack(Audio::SeekableAudioStream *stream) | Video::VideoDecoder | |
addTrack(Track *track, bool isExternal=false) | Video::VideoDecoder | protected |
AudioCompression enum name (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
audioInfo (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
audioS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
close() | Video::SmackerDecoder | virtual |
createVideoTrack(uint32 width, uint32 height, uint32 frameCount, const Common::Rational &frameRate, uint32 flags, uint32 version) const override (defined in Toon::ToonstruckSmackerDecoder) | Toon::ToonstruckSmackerDecoder | protectedvirtual |
decodeNextFrame() | Video::VideoDecoder | virtual |
delayMillis(uint msecs) | Video::VideoDecoder | |
dummy (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
endOfVideo() const | Video::VideoDecoder | |
endOfVideoTracks() const | Video::VideoDecoder | protected |
eraseTrack(Track *track) | Video::VideoDecoder | protected |
findNextVideoTrack() | Video::VideoDecoder | protected |
flags (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
forceSeekToFrame(uint frame) (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
fullS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
getAudioTrack(int index) | Video::SmackerDecoder | protectedvirtual |
getAudioTrackCount() const | Video::VideoDecoder | |
getBalance() const | Video::VideoDecoder | inline |
getCurFrame() const | Video::VideoDecoder | |
getDuration() const | Video::VideoDecoder | virtual |
getEndTime() const | Video::VideoDecoder | inline |
getFrameCount() const | Video::VideoDecoder | |
getFrameRate() const (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
getHeight() const | Video::VideoDecoder | virtual |
getNextDirtyRect() (defined in Video::SmackerDecoder) | Video::SmackerDecoder | virtual |
getNumTracks() (defined in Video::VideoDecoder) | Video::VideoDecoder | inlineprotected |
getPalette() | Video::VideoDecoder | |
getPixelFormat() const | Video::VideoDecoder | |
getRate() const | Video::VideoDecoder | inline |
getSignatureVersion(uint32 signature) const (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protectedvirtual |
getSoundType() const | Video::VideoDecoder | |
getTime() const | Video::VideoDecoder | |
getTimeToNextFrame() const | Video::VideoDecoder | |
getTrack(uint track) | Video::VideoDecoder | protected |
getTrack(uint track) const | Video::VideoDecoder | protected |
getTrackListBegin() | Video::VideoDecoder | inlineprotected |
getTrackListEnd() | Video::VideoDecoder | inlineprotected |
getVolume() const | Video::VideoDecoder | inline |
getWidth() const | Video::VideoDecoder | virtual |
handleAudioTrack(byte track, uint32 chunkSize, uint32 unpackedSize) override (defined in Toon::ToonstruckSmackerDecoder) | Toon::ToonstruckSmackerDecoder | protectedvirtual |
hasAudio() const (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
hasDirtyPalette() const | Video::VideoDecoder | inline |
hasFramesLeft() const (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
isLowRes() (defined in Toon::ToonstruckSmackerDecoder) | Toon::ToonstruckSmackerDecoder | inline |
isPaused() const | Video::VideoDecoder | inline |
isPlaying() const | Video::VideoDecoder | |
isRewindable() const | Video::VideoDecoder | virtual |
isSeekable() const | Video::VideoDecoder | virtual |
isVideoLoaded() const | Video::VideoDecoder | |
kCompressionDCT enum value (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
kCompressionDPCM enum value (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
kCompressionNone enum value (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
kCompressionRDFT enum value (defined in Video::SmackerDecoder) | Video::SmackerDecoder | protected |
loadFile(const Common::Path &filename) | Video::VideoDecoder | virtual |
loadStream(Common::SeekableReadStream *stream) override | Toon::ToonstruckSmackerDecoder | virtual |
mClrS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
mMapS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
needsUpdate() const | Video::VideoDecoder | |
pauseVideo(bool pause) | Video::VideoDecoder | |
readNextPacket() | Video::SmackerDecoder | protectedvirtual |
resetPauseStartTime() | Video::VideoDecoder | protected |
resetStartTime() | Video::VideoDecoder | |
rewind() | Video::SmackerDecoder | virtual |
seek(const Audio::Timestamp &time) | Video::VideoDecoder | |
seekIntern(const Audio::Timestamp &time) | Video::VideoDecoder | protectedvirtual |
seekToFrame(uint frame) | Video::VideoDecoder | virtual |
setAudioRate(Common::Rational rate) (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
setAudioTrack(int index) | Video::VideoDecoder | |
setBalance(int8 balance) | Video::VideoDecoder | |
setDitheringPalette(const byte *palette) | Video::VideoDecoder | |
setEndFrame(uint frame) | Video::VideoDecoder | |
setEndTime(const Audio::Timestamp &endTime) | Video::VideoDecoder | |
setOutputPixelFormat(const Graphics::PixelFormat &format) | Video::VideoDecoder | |
setOutputPixelFormats(const Common::List< Graphics::PixelFormat > &formatList) | Video::VideoDecoder | |
setRate(const Common::Rational &rate) | Video::VideoDecoder | |
setReverse(bool reverse) | Video::VideoDecoder | |
setSoundType(Audio::Mixer::SoundType soundType) | Video::VideoDecoder | |
setVideoCodecAccuracy(Image::CodecAccuracy accuracy) | Video::VideoDecoder | virtual |
setVolume(byte volume) | Video::VideoDecoder | |
signature (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
SmackerDecoder() (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
start() | Video::VideoDecoder | |
startAudio() (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
startAudioLimit(const Audio::Timestamp &limit) (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
stop() | Video::VideoDecoder | |
stopAudio() (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
supportsAudioTrackSwitching() const | Video::SmackerDecoder | inlineprotectedvirtual |
ToonstruckSmackerDecoder() (defined in Toon::ToonstruckSmackerDecoder) | Toon::ToonstruckSmackerDecoder | |
TrackList typedef | Video::VideoDecoder | protected |
TrackListIterator typedef (defined in Video::VideoDecoder) | Video::VideoDecoder | protected |
treesS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
typeSize (defined in Video::SmackerDecoder) | Video::SmackerDecoder | |
useAudioSync() const | Video::VideoDecoder | inlineprotectedvirtual |
VideoDecoder() (defined in Video::VideoDecoder) | Video::VideoDecoder | |
~SmackerDecoder() (defined in Video::SmackerDecoder) | Video::SmackerDecoder | virtual |
~VideoDecoder() (defined in Video::VideoDecoder) | Video::VideoDecoder | inlinevirtual |